I’m seeing the same rumors float around the internet for Free Dining 2017 the past couple of days – enough to share it here.  The following information came from DisneyTouristBlog:

“Rumors are starting to fly that Free Dining will be released on April 24, 2017. As best I can tell, this info is coming exclusively from a Brazilian travel agency.

Normally, I’d write this off. Info leaking out this far in advance of the release date is fairly unprecedented. However, the details seem plausible and I see others reporting the same info (they could just be regurgitating the same rumor, though). Given that, I thought I’d at least share, as an FYI.

Rumored Free Dining dates:

• August 13 – September 30, 2017
• November 14 – 20, 2017
• November 25 – 27, 2017
• December 8 – 23, 2017
As part of this rumor, both Value and Moderate Resorts receive the Quick Service Disney Dining Plan, while Deluxe and Deluxe Villa Resorts receive the standard Disney Dining Plan.

The big pieces of news here: moderates are only receiving the Quick Service Disney Dining Plan.

If this rumor is accurate, that suggests to me Disney is pretty confident in its bookings thus far for the summer, and occupancy projections for this fall and winter. With Pandora in Animal Kingdom opening and record consumer confidence in the United States, this wouldn’t surprise me. In fact, the details and internal consistency of this rumor make it highly plausible in my view.”

 

Of course, this is all a lot of speculation about a rumor that I think could very well be incorrect, but again, I wanted to share since this is the consistent information floating around the internet right now 🙂
